Apr 4, 2022 · Instead, it’s tied to Kansas’ state history. As explained by KU’s Athletics website, “The term ‘Jayhawk’ was probably coined around 1848. Accounts of its use appeared from Illinois to Texas, and in that year, a party of pioneers crossing what is now Nebraska called themselves ‘The Jayhawkers of ’49’. The name combines two ... There is a good reason for that: Jayhawks are mythical birds, not real ones. Nevertheless, that doesn't mean that the Kansas Jayhawk hasn't played an important role in the state over the years. The bird, which is the official mascot of the University of Kansas, has a long and storied history that stretches back all the way to the mid-1800s.

Murphy was Creighton’s public relations director in the early ’40s when he commissioned an artist to draw Billy. This will come as painful news to many Creighton fans, but, according to Murphy’s account, Billy Bluejay was inspired by the Kansas Jayhawk. Yet Murphy thought the Jayhawk looked too “complacent and satisfied.”

Baby Jay was created by student Amy Sue Hurst and "hatched" at half-time of KU's Homecoming victory in football over Kansas State University on October 9, 1971, and has served as a mascot ever since. [2] History In 1970 Amy Hurst saw a Jayhawk bumper sticker depicting Big Jay and hatchlings, which inspired her to create a new mascot. [3]

"Captain" is the official name of UT Martin's costumed Skyhawk mascot. The name, "Captain", was selected because it's a gender-neutral name that fits the concept of a mythical hawk that flies a plane. The Jayhawk was not always KU's lone mascot. KU's first mascot was the Bulldog. For a while, the Jayhawk and the Bulldog were used as the mascot, at the same time. In November of 1958, the Jayhawk became KU's official, and lone, mascot. Jayhawk Mascot with Bulldog, 1917.
